January Weather in Caldas, Colombia

Last updated: August 21, 2025

Caldas, Colombia in January offers a delightful blend of warm temperatures and abundant rainfall, making it a unique month for visitors. With a maximum temperature reaching 31°C (88°F) and an average of 20°C (68°F), the weather invites outdoor exploration. However, be prepared for occasional showers, as precipitation amounts to 90 mm (3.5 in) over 14 days. The average humidity level is a comfortable 78%, contributing to the region's lush landscapes. January Precipitation in Caldas

In Caldas, Colombia, January kicks off the year with moderate precipitation, registering about 90 mm (3.5 in) over approximately 14 rainy days. This sets a foundation for an increase in moisture as the months progress, with February experiencing a notable rise to 117 mm (4.6 in) and 17 rain-soaked days. This trend peaks in May, when the region receives an impressive 301 mm (11.8 in) across 28 days, highlighting the area's transition into its wetter season. The consistent increase in precipitation is complemented by a steady number of rainy days, which indicates that while January is relatively dry, the onset of spring ushers in significantly heavier rainfall, contributing to the lush landscape that defines Caldas. By December, the rainfall subsides to 105 mm (4.1 in), reminding us that the cycle of wetness is a defining feature of this vibrant Colombian region.

January Humidity in Caldas

In January, Caldas, Colombia, experiences a humidity level of 78%, setting the tone for a year characterized by substantial moisture in the air. This initial figure slightly dips to 77% in February, but as spring approaches, humidity begins its upward trend, reaching 80% in March and climbing steadily throughout the following months. By May and June, humidity peaks at 87%, signaling the region's transition into its wettest season. The summer months see a slight decrease, with humidity values hovering around 85% in July and dropping to 80% in August and September. However, as the year rounds out, humidity levels remain relatively high, ranging from 83% to 87% in the final months. UV Risk Categories

  •  Extreme (11+): Avoid the sun, stay in shade.
  •  Very High (8-10): Limit sun exposure.
  •  High (6-7): Use SPF 30+ and protective clothing.
  •  Moderate (3-5): Midday shade recommended.
  •  Low (0-2): No protection needed.
